The Open Works License. The Open Works License, henceforth also referred to as the OWL, was developed to fill the need for a copyfree. License that does not limit itself in its intended application to software or any other particular content form. It is intended to be understandable to the layman while still providing adequate legal protection and clarity for the terms of the license.
